Output d2338783abb01b53cedba82426a3d19890524febf7202f9cf5177a3218311675:6

value
47655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afe221b7b5c489a34bef1cad24e6dc8029ff272b OP_EQUAL
address
3Hj1529szm69yaQnHowmC2TetZCyzMehUg
transaction
d2338783abb01b53cedba82426a3d19890524febf7202f9cf5177a3218311675
confirmations
152322
spent
true